⚾ Comeback Noles! No. 4 FSU Rallies Past Stetson for 30th Win
Noles Win!!!
FSU rallies to beat Stetson 11-6 at Howser!
— FSU Baseball (@FSUBaseball)
12:24 AM • Apr 23, 2025
Resilience + fireworks = another W at The Howser. 💣🔥
No. 4 Florida State stormed back from a 4-0 deficit to beat Stetson 11–6 Tuesday night, improving to 30–7 on the season and extending their home win streak over the Hatters to 19 straight.
📈 Game Highlights:
• Gage Harrelson: 2 hits, 4 RBI, diving catch + homer
• Chase Williams: 2 hits, 4 SBs (tied 4th-most in FSU history), 2 RBI, 3 R
• Hunter Carns: 3-run 💣 in the 7th to ice it — his 6th of the year
• Max Williams: Team-leading 15th HR
• John Abraham (W, 3-0): 1.2 scoreless innings in relief
• Chris Knier: Locked it down with a clean 2-inning save
🔢 Stat Sheet:
• FSU: 11 runs on 8 hits | 3 HRs
• Stetson: 6 runs on 10 hits | 3 errors
• FSU now 70–26 all-time vs. Stetson
🛣️ Next Up: Top-20 showdown at No. 19 Louisville (April 25–27)
🚪 Transfer Alert: CB Jeremiah Wilson Visiting FSU Thursday
Houston DB Jeremiah Wilson is entering the transfer portal, he tells @RivalsFriedman
Wilson earned a top 10 coverage grade among Power 4 CBs last season per PFF. He had 4 INTs and 5 PBUs in 2024
— NCAA Transfer Portal (@RivalsPortal)
2:18 PM • Apr 18, 2025
One of the top defensive backs in the portal is heading to Tallahassee. 👀
Houston cornerback Jeremiah Wilson will visit Florida State on Thursday, he confirmed to Noles247 — his only scheduled visit at this time.
📋 Quick Profile:
• 🏈 5'10", 185 lbs | Kissimmee, FL native
• ⭐ 92 Transfer Portal Grade (247Sports)
• 📈 2024: 16 tackles, 4 INTs, 4 PBUs | 86.4 PFF Grade
• 🔁 Recruited by Tony White at Syracuse (2022)
🎯 Why It Matters:
• Cornerback remains one of FSU’s most pressing portal needs
• Wilson brings elite production + system familiarity under Tony White
🏈 Post-Spring Offensive Two-Deep: Early Fall Forecast for FSU
2025 Florida State’s explosive threats
🍢 WR Squirrel White (5’9/170)
🍢 RB Jaylin Lucas (5’7/173)— Clay Fink (@clay_fink)
7:34 PM • Apr 22, 2025
Florida State wrapped up spring practice and is now moving into the exit interview phase — but before more portal movement, here's where the offense stands today. 🔍
📋 Projected Two-Deep (Offense)
Quarterback
1️⃣ Tommy Castellanos ("The Franchise")
2️⃣ Brock Glenn
🧠 Freshman Kevin Sperry flashed legit upside — sub-package potential?
Running Back
1️⃣ Roydell Williams (RB1 for now)
2️⃣ Jaylin Lucas / Ousmane Kromah (Top-5 recruit arrives this summer)
Tight End / H-Back
• Landen Thomas / Markeston Douglas (in-line)
• Randy Pittman / Chase Loftin (H-back, flex weapons)
Wide Receiver
• 9-WR: Duce Robinson / Elijah Moore
• 2-WR (sweep): Squirrel White / Lawayne McCoy or Micahi Danzy
• Slot WR: Jayvan Boggs (🔝 spring riser) / BJ Gibson
Offensive Line
• LT: Gunnar Hansen / Lucas Simmons
• LG: Adrian Medley / Andre’ Otto or Jacob Rizy
• C: Luke Petitbon (leader of the unit) / Otto or Rizy
• RG: Richie Leonard / Otto or Rizy
• RT: Micah Pettus / Jonathan Daniels
🎯 Big Picture:
• Castellanos, Robinson, White, and Thomas = a strong core
• OL health and WR depth remain question marks
• Incoming freshmen (Kromah, Gelsey) could shake things up early
🚪 Transfer Portal Watch: FSU Ramping Up Post-Weekend
Miami DB Zaquan Patterson is entering the transfer portal, sources confirm to @RivalsFriedman
Patterson was a top 40 prospect in the 2024 class. He played in 12 games as a true freshman
— NCAA Transfer Portal (@RivalsPortal)
12:08 AM • Apr 15, 2025
After a quiet few days on the recruiting trail due to the campus shutdown, things are picking up again in Tallahassee — and Florida State is refocusing efforts on key portal targets with just days left in the spring window. 🔁
📍 Where Things Stand:
Following the departures of three wide receivers, FSU is actively evaluating replacement options at WR, while also monitoring high-impact defenders at safety and on the defensive line.
📈 Notable Portal Targets:
WR TreyShun Hurry (San Jose State)
Explosive playmaker with offers from FSU, Miami, Tennessee, and more. A visit could materialize soon.WR Keelon Marion (BYU)
Productive and experienced — FSU interest is “moving fast” according to insiders.DB Zaquan Patterson (Miami transfer)
Former 4⭐ recruit — visited Ole Miss, headed to Florida next. FSU could get a visit, but may currently trail.DB Jeremiah Wilson (Houston)
Tony White connection. Orlando native with versatility at safety/corner. Visit to FSU is expected Thursday. A push here makes the 'Noles a major contender.DL Bernard Gooden (USF)
New portal entrant from Alabama. 37 tackles, 10 TFL in 2024. FSU evaluating closely.DL Akelo Stone (Ole Miss)
Contacted by FSU and others. 15 tackles, 1.5 sacks in 2024. A visit could be on the horizon.
🎯 What’s Next:
Originally expected to take 3–4 players, FSU could expand that number due to recent attrition. Positions of focus:
Wide Receiver ✅
Safety/Defensive Back ✅
Defensive Line ✅
Offensive Line/Corners — still being evaluated
🕔 Reminder:
The spring portal window closes Friday, April 25, but player commitments can continue beyond that. Expect visits, offers, and decisions to unfold well into May.
📅 Five Key Recruits FSU Must Lock In for Summer Officials
Four-star Edge Tristian Givens here today for #FSU spring practice.
— Warchant.com (@Warchant)
2:08 PM • Apr 5, 2025
Spring visits are winding down, and with over 60 official visitors already expected in June, Florida State’s staff is hustling to lock in a few more top-tier targets. 🔑
Here are five names the ‘Noles must secure for official visits ASAP:
⭐️ 5-Star LB Xavier Griffin (USC commit)
• FSU was an early offer and has hosted Griffin twice
• Noles remain a top challenger to USC
• Word is FSU will get an OV — but it’s not locked in yet
🌟 4-Star DL Deuce Geralds
• One of FSU’s top 2026 DL targets
• Two spring visits = strong momentum
• Need to beat out Michigan, OSU, LSU, Oklahoma for a summer visit slot
🌟 4-Star OT Kamari Blair
• Rapid riser on FSU’s board
• Recent visit went well, but his OVs are booked (Vandy, South Carolina, Ole Miss, Kentucky)
• FSU must elbow into that rotation — and fast
🌟 4-Star LB Adam Balogoun-Ali
• Top in-state LB who’s yet to visit FSU
• Included FSU in his Top 8 — now staff must convert that into an official
🌟 4-Star EDGE Tristian Givens
• Elite pass rusher — FSU in his Top 4 with Tennessee, USC, and Texas A&M
• No OV date set yet, but FSU needs to get one locked in
🎯 Bottom Line:
The 2026 class momentum is real — now it’s about sealing the deal with summer official visits.
